The most typical kind of hydraulic pump is the gear pump. Gear pumps are comparatively easy in design and are very efficient. However, they are often noisy and generate lots of heat. Other sorts of hydraulic pumps embody vane pumps, piston pumps, and screw pumps. Vane pumps are similar to gear pumps, however they use vanes as a substitute of gears to create a stress differential. Piston pumps are extra environment friendly than gear pumps, but they're additionally costlier and advanced. With reciprocating pumps, the upstroke of the plunger or piston creates a vacuum. In gear pumps or lobe pumps, because the teeth or lobes mesh then come apart, a vacuum is created. The distinction in strain creates suction. A liquid under greater stress will move to an space of lower pressure. The essential advantages of optimistic displacement pumps over nonpositive displacement pumps embrace the aptitude to generate high pressures, excessive volumetric efficiency, and high energy to weight ratio. The change in the effectivity of optimistic displacement pumps throughout the strain range is small and the operating vary of strain and velocity is wider.
